Addressable Spend Definition

Addressable spend refers to the portion of a company’s total spending that can be directly attributed to a specific marketing campaign or channel. This is typically calculated as a percentage of total marketing spend. For example, if a company spends $1,000 on marketing and $200 can be attributed to a specific campaign, then the addressable spend for that campaign would be 20%.

Addressable spend is an important metric for marketers to track because it allows them to see which campaigns are driving results and which ones are not. It also helps marketers allocate their resources more effectively by allowing them to focus on the campaigns that are yielding the greatest return on investment.
